About the Role
We are seeking an experienced and strategic leader to step into the role of Engineering Services Manager, responsible for overseeing the delivery of core infrastructure services, including roading, solid waste, and development engineering.
This position plays a critical role in ensuring these services are delivered efficiently, sustainably, and in alignment with Council's long-term objectives.
The Key Responsibilities for this position are :
Lead and manage the Engineering Services team to deliver high-performing, efficient outcomes
Build strong, collaborative relationships with internal teams and external agencies (e.g. NZTA, Waikato Regional Council, MfE)
Secure internal and external funding to support key projects and service delivery
Provide expert technical and strategic advice on infrastructure planning and asset management
Act as Engineer to Contract for capital and operational works, ensuring delivery meets scope, quality, and compliance standards
About You
You will bring strong leadership capability, sound technical expertise, and a proven ability to operate at a strategic level.
You'll also demonstrate excellent relationship management skills and a clear understanding of the political and regulatory environment in which local government operates.
Your background will include :
A relevant tertiary qualification in Civil Engineering, with Chartered Professional Engineer (CPEng) status and full membership of a recognised engineering body
A minimum of five years' experience in a senior leadership role within the engineering or infrastructure sector
In-depth understanding of local government legislation and compliance requirements
Familiarity with the Treaty of Waitangi and Tikanga Maori, and their relevance in the local government context
Working knowledge of NZS3910 and 3917
Demonstrated experience in managing external relationships with government agencies and stakeholders
A proven track record in the development, procurement, and delivery of infrastructure contracts
Strong commercial, political, and financial acumen
